This report documents work done to support the FAA’s development of Unmanned Aerial Systems (UAS) noise certification and noise measurement criteria. The report discusses the applicability of the Code of Federal Regulation Title 14, Part 36, Appendix J, section J36.205(b) for UAS noise certification. The duration correction in the Appendix J noise certification standard was developed based on observations of aircraft operations in the 1980s. A noise measurement program conducted on a small UAS vehicle at Stow Massachusetts showed that this vehicle’s noise characteristics are not well modeled by the Appendix j duration correction. The report concludes that the Appendix J duration correction should not be used to extrapolate noise measurements at closer distances to the Appendix J fly-over height.
